PVC pipe glue, technically called solvent cement, doesn’t actually “glue” pipes together in the traditional sense. Instead, it creates a chemical weld by dissolving the outer layers of both the pipe and fitting, which then fuse together as the solvent evaporates. This creates a permanent, watertight bond that’s stronger than the pipe itself when done correctly.

Understanding what is PVC pipe helps you appreciate why proper gluing technique is crucial. PVC (Polyvinyl Chloride) is a thermoplastic material widely used in plumbing, irrigation systems, and drainage applications due to its durability, affordability, and resistance to corrosion.

Accurate cutting is the foundation of a successful PVC connection. Use a PVC pipe cutter or fine-toothed saw to make a clean, square cut. Uneven cuts create gaps that prevent proper bonding.

After cutting, remove all burrs and rough edges using a deburring tool or sandpaper. Burrs prevent the pipe from fully seating in the fitting and create weak spots where leaks can develop.

PVC cement sets in 5-15 minutes for light handling, but requires 24 hours for full cure before pressure testing. Temperature and humidity affect drying time significantly.
No, you must use CPVC-specific cement for CPVC pipes. Using wrong cement type results in joint failure. Learn more about CPVC vs PVC differences.
Yes, absolutely! PVC primer is essential for creating a proper chemical weld. Skipping primer is the #1 cause of premature joint failure.
Ideal temperature range is 50-110°F (10-43°C). Below 40°F, use special low-temperature cement and extend cure times. Above 110°F, cement sets too quickly.
Apply a generous, even coat that completely covers all surfaces. You should see a continuous bead around the joint after assembly. Too much is better than too little.
No, surfaces must be completely dry. Water prevents proper chemical bonding and causes joint failure. Wipe pipes dry and wait for moisture to evaporate.

Once cured, PVC cement cannot be removed – it’s a permanent chemical weld. For mistakes, you must cut out the joint and start over. Learn about removing PVC glue from surfaces.
Unopened: 2-3 years. Once opened, use within 6-12 months for best results. Cement becomes thick and less effective over time.
You should see a purple (or clear) stain extending beyond where the pipe inserts into the fitting. If you can’t see distinct primer coverage, apply more.
No, attempting to add more cement over a cured joint doesn’t work. The only proper fix is to cut out the joint and redo it correctly.
Yes, always! Apply cement to both surfaces for maximum bond strength. Applying to only one surface results in weak, unreliable joints.
The pipe should fully seat to the socket depth. Most fittings have a built-in stop. Mark depth during dry-fitting to ensure complete insertion.
No, they’re the same product. “Glue” is a common term, but “solvent cement” is technically correct since it chemically welds rather than glues.
